M.M. answers from Chicago on December 05, 2008
Household Hazardous Waste drop off site
Fire Station #4
1971 Brookdale Road
Naperville, IL
###-###-####
Sat and Sun 9-2 pm excluding holidays
www.naperville.il.us/hhw.aspx#Accepted
Per website, household batteries are accepted. Consult above website for more details. Also check at IKEA stores. I believe my husband has dropped off those CFL compact flor light bulbs and maybe household batteries there too.
